
Ivabradine (5mg)
Active composition
Ivabradine selectively inhibits the If current in the sinoatrial node, reducing heart rate without affecting contractility.
Medical applications
Genericart Ivabradine Hydrochloride 5mg Tablet contains Ivabradine 5mg, a selective inhibitor of the If current in the sinoatrial node, used primarily to manage chronic stable angina and heart failure. By specifically reducing the heart rate without affecting myocardial contractility or intracardiac conduction, Ivabradine improves myocardial oxygen balance and reduces symptoms associated with angina pectoris. It is indicated for patients with stable angina who are in sinus rhythm and have a contraindication or intolerance to beta-blockers or as an adjunct to beta-blockers when heart rate control is insufficient. Additionally, it is prescribed for patients with chronic heart failure with reduced ejection fraction (HFrEF) who remain symptomatic despite optimal standard therapy, including beta-blockers, ACE inhibitors, or ARBs. The recommended dosage is individualized based on heart rate response, with careful monitoring to avoid bradycardia. Ivabradine is contraindicated in patients with acute decompensated heart failure, sinoatrial block, severe hepatic impairment, or pacemaker dependence. Common adverse effects include bradycardia, luminous phenomena (phosphenes), and headaches. Caution is advised when co-administered with other heart rate-lowering agents. Genericart Ivabradine Hydrochloride 5mg Tablet should be used under medical supervision with regular cardiac monitoring to optimize therapeutic outcomes.

It is not known whether it is safe to consume alcohol with Genericart Ivabradine Hydrochloride 5mg Tablet. Please consult your doctor.
High Risk
Genericart Ivabradine Hydrochloride 5mg Tablet is highly unsafe to use during pregnancy. Seek your doctor's advice as studies on pregnant women and animals have shown significant harmful effects to the developing baby.
Medical Advice
Genericart Ivabradine Hydrochloride 5mg Tablet may cause side effects which could affect your ability to drive. Genericart Ivabradine Hydrochloride 5mg Tablet may cause transient luminous phenomena consisting mainly of phosphenes. The possible occurrence of such luminous phenomena should be taken into account especially when driving at night.
Exercise Caution
Genericart Ivabradine Hydrochloride 5mg Tablet should be used with caution in patients with liver disease. Dose adjustment of Genericart Ivabradine Hydrochloride 5mg Tablet may be needed. Please consult your doctor. Use of Genericart Ivabradine Hydrochloride 5mg Tablet is not recommended in patients with severe liver disease.
Regular Checkup
Genericart Ivabradine Hydrochloride 5mg Tablet is unsafe to use during breastfeeding. Data suggests that the drug may cause toxicity to the baby.
Consult Doctor
Genericart Ivabradine Hydrochloride 5mg Tablet should be used with caution in patients with severe kidney disease. Dose adjustment of Genericart Ivabradine Hydrochloride 5mg Tablet may be needed. Please consult your doctor. Limited information is available for use of Genericart Ivabradine Hydrochloride 5mg Tablet in patients with severe kidney disease.
